# The highest electricity content in the entire market, the green electricity ETF ChinaAMC (562550) has the highest trading volume in its category, enabling a one-click layout for the energy transition

On April 9th, the three major A-share indices opened lower collectively. After a decline at the opening, the power sector rebounded from the bottom, with the decline narrowing continuously. As of 10:06, the Grid Equipment ETF ChinaAMC (159326) fell by 0.63%, and the Green Electricity ETF ChinaAMC (562550) fell by 0.85%, with a transaction volume reaching 41.09 million yuan, maintaining the top position in its category. The stocks held, including Qianyuan Power, China Power Investment Hydropower, YN Energy Holdings, Datang Power, and Guangzhou Development, saw significant gains.

The ongoing tension in the Middle East has significantly disturbed global energy market sentiment, accelerating the global energy transition process. Recently, the National Bureau of Statistics stated that it will work with relevant departments to vigorously promote the collaborative project of computing power and electricity, ensuring that the proportion of green electricity applications in newly built computing power facilities at hub nodes reaches over 80%, maximizing the supporting role of green electricity.

Bank of China Securities believes that by 2026, all links in the new energy sector, including photovoltaics, wind power, batteries, and energy storage, will perform well. The current industry still has a high cost-performance ratio for allocation, and investment opportunities are worth paying attention to.

**Green Electricity ETF ChinaAMC (562550):** The largest in scale among the same index, tracking the CSI Green Electricity Index, with over 99% power content in the Shenwan secondary industry, making it the "purest" power-related index in the market. It packages leading power companies in one click, including clean energy companies represented by hydropower, wind power, and photovoltaic power generation, as well as samples of energy transition such as thermal power and nuclear power. The "wind, solar, water, and nuclear" content exceeds 56%, and the constituent stocks include Datang Power, GCL-Poly Energy, Jinkai New Energy, YN Energy, Green Power, and energy-saving wind power, among others.

**Grid Equipment ETF ChinaAMC (159326):** The only ETF in the market tracking the CSI Grid Equipment Theme Index, with over 75% grid equipment content in the Shenwan secondary industry, making it the purest grid index in the market. The weight of smart grid accounts for as much as 90%, and the weight of ultra-high voltage accounts for 70%, both the highest in the market.
